Director Of Men's Ministry

The Director of Men's Ministry provides leadership and direction for discipling men at First Alliance Church (FAC). This role focuses on developing leaders, fostering relational discipleship, and creating environments where men grow as Spirit-empowered followers of Jesus Christ who actively disciple others.

This is a part time job, approximately 20 hours per week.

Primary Responsibilities:

Discipleship & Teaching

Lead men's Bible studies and teaching environments

Create opportunities for sound, biblical teaching

Promote a culture of discipleship and spiritual growth

Encourage participation in small, accountable groups

Mentorship

Provide group and one-on-one mentoring

Develop and multiply mentors within the ministry

Equip men to disciple other men

Leadership Development

Identify, train, and support volunteer leaders

Invest in emerging leaders, including a Greenhouse Resident

Build sustainable systems for leadership multiplication

Events & Ministry Environments

Lead planning and execution of key events:
Spring Men's Conference and Men's Fall Retreat

Create additional environments for teaching, connection, and outreach

Community Building

Foster authentic relationships and accountability among men

Create clear pathways for engagement and connection

Encourage consistent participation in discipleship relationships

Strategic Collaboration

Work with the Men's Ministry Wisdom Team to shape vision and direction

Collaborate with church staff to align ministry efforts

Maintain regular communication with the Lead Pastor

Administration

Develop and manage the annual Men's Ministry budget in alignment with church priorities

Plan and submit yearly budget proposals, including projected expenses for events, resources, and ministry initiatives

Steward allocated funds responsibly, ensuring all spending aligns with approved budget and ministry goals

Monitor expenses throughout the year and adjust plans as needed to remain on budget

Evaluate cost-effectiveness of events and initiatives to maximize ministry impact within financial constraints

Maintain clear communication with church leadership regarding budget needs, changes, and performance

Oversee ministry planning, scheduling, and logistics within a 20-hour work week

Track engagement, participation, and leadership development metrics

Key Outcomes

Increased engagement in discipleship relationships

Growth in participation in studies, mentoring, and events

Development and multiplication of leaders

Strong relational community among men

Ongoing culture of men discipling other men

Qualifications

Growing, active relationship with Jesus Christ

Alignment with FAC's mission and theology

Ability to teach and communicate Scripture effectively

Strong relational and leadership skills

Experience in discipleship, mentoring, or ministry leadership preferred

Effective organizational and time-management skills

Core Competencies

Relational discipleship

Leadership development and multiplication

Strategic thinking

Communication and teaching

Team leadership and execution
